When you start thinking about a waterfront home in the Fort Lauderdale area it is important to be aware that all waterfront is not the same and we are going to ask many questions to make sure you find the right property. When you see a photo on the internet of a lake front home for $200,000 chances are this is a lake, with access to no major waterways, hence we may ask you if the water is about a view or about a boat. Other things we may wish to talk about, ocean access, fixed bridges, beam, depth, width of a canal, timing to the intracoastal, distance to the inlet. As a starting point, you can count on the larger boat you can house in your backyard the more expensive the property will be. It is rare to find a no fixed bridge, waterfront home under the $600,000 mark even in our current market.
